Mayor Duke asked City Manager Baldwin to follow-up with staff. 3.2 Presentation by City Auditor, Keefe, McCullough & Co., of Comprehensive Annual Financial Report(CAFR) Cindy Calvert, Keefe, McCullough& Co., gave an overview of the results of the Comprehensive Annual Financial Report, which was included in the agenda packet. Commissioner Flury commented she does not agree with the amount of reserves the City maintains and feels it should be between $8-10 million because of issues associated with the City's age. She noted in the management letter, comments about problems with the water meters appear for the second year in a row and it is time to take significant action to resolve the issue. Commissioner Flury questioned how the $1.7 million in the CRA Reserve account can be used. Mark Bates, Finance Director, explained the $1.7 million is the remaining balance after CRA receipt and expenditure of County money, and transfers and funding from the General Fund. He noted that $1.2 million of this balance has been appropriated for specific capital projects and there is $550,000.00 remaining. Commissioner Flury remarked there is perhaps $10 million remaining in State Revolving Funds available to borrow and it might be time to think about doing a new water/sewer/wastewater plan to carry us through the next ten years. Commissioner Grace agreed we should have larger reserves. Vice-Mayor Jones questioned the gate arm system in the parking garage, in particular, the funding and whether the system is operable. Finance Director Bates responded County grant money is due to the City for funds that were expended and the gate arms are operable. City Manager Baldwin noted the request for the funds has been submitted to the County. Colin Donnelly, Assistant City Manager, said the County wants to do a field test, so arrangements will need to be made to turn the system on and make it operational in order to accommodate them. Mayor Duke commented there are five or six near-term financial landmines to be dealt with, including coastal erosion, pension and healthcare issues, water, regional emergency communications, and CRA grants triggering to loans. He asked if the auditors opined on these matters. Ms. Calvert responded these issues are not within the scope of the audit. 4. Proclamations There were no proclamations at this meeting. 5. Commissioner Flury noted cities generally change auditors every three to five years and asked how long this company has been providing services to Dania Beach. Mark Bates, Finance Director, responded the firm began in 2007. Commissioner Flury recommended that we go out to bid for auditing services due to the length of service of the current firm. Commissioner Flury motioned to go out to bid for auditing services; seconded by Vice- Mayor Jones. Finance Director Bates noted an audit selection committee is required pursuant to state statutes and discussed the acceptable make-up of the committee. Commissioner Flury added to the motion to include establishing the Commission as the selection committee. The motion carried on the following 5-0 Roll Call vote: Commissioner Brandimarte Yes Vice-Mayor Jones Yes Commissioner Flury Yes Mayor Duke Yes Commissioner Grace Yes City Attorney Ansbro noted that Resolution#2013-042 was withdrawn from the agenda. 8. Discussion and Possible Action 10.1 Discussion of Ordinance #2013-003 AN ORDINANCE OF THE CITY COMMISSION OF THE CITY OF DANIA BEACH, FLORIDA, CONSENTING TO BE INCLUDED IN A MUNICIPAL SERVICES TAXING UNIT "MSTU" FOR A CONSOLIDATED REGIONAL E-911 COMMUNICATIONS SYSTEM CREATED BY BROWARD COUNTY ORDINANCE, FOR THE PERIOD OF TIME NOT TO EXCEED FIVE (5) YEARS; PROVIDING FOR Minutes of Regular Meeting 5 Dania Beach City Commission Tuesday,April 9,2013—7:00 p.m. CONFLICTS; PROVIDING FOR SEVERABILITY; FURTHER, PROVIDING FOR AN EFFECTIVE DATE. (FIRST READING) City Attorney Ansbro read the title of Ordinance#2013-003. City Manager Baldwin gave an overview of the issue and recommended passing the ordinance on first reading in order to keep our options open. Vice-Mayor Jones expressed concerns about the County's direction, noting we are being pressured to make decisions without all of the information and he favors opting out. Commissioner Flury commented this is blackmail and she will not participate in it. City Manager Baldwin noted there will be a meeting tomorrow for all the cities to discuss and possibly decide what to do next. He advised there will not be an opportunity for the Commission to make a decision if this ordinance is not passed on first reading. Vice-Mayor Jones asked if we could put money in escrow, opt out, and wait to see what happens. City Attorney Ansbro responded he would like to see this go to a circuit judge for a declaratory judgment and asked City Manager Baldwin to discuss this tomorrow with the other cities. Commissioner Grace motioned to adopt Ordinance #2013-003, on first reading; seconded by Commissioner Brandimarte. The motion carried on the following 3-2 Roll Call vote: Commissioner Brandimarte Yes Vice-Mayor Jones No Commissioner Flury No Mayor Duke Yes Commissioner Grace Yes 11.
